Certificates; Other Information. Deliver to the Administrative Agent, in form and detail satisfactory to the Administrative Agent:
(a) concurrently with the delivery of the financial statements referred to in Sections 6.01(a) and (b), a duly completed Compliance Certificate signed by a Responsible Officer of the Borrower;
(b) promptly after any request by the Administrative Agent or any Lender, copies of any detailed and final audit reports, management letters or recommendations submitted to the board of directors (or the audit committee of the board of directors) of the Borrower by independent accountants in connection with the accounts or books of the Borrower or any Subsidiary, or any audit of any of them;
(c) promptly after the same are available, copies of each annual report, proxy or financial statement or other report or communication sent to the stockholders of the Borrower, and copies of all annual, regular, periodic and special reports and registration statements which the Borrower may file or be required to file with the SEC under Section 13 or 15(d) of the Exchange Act, and not otherwise required to be delivered to the Administrative Agent pursuant hereto;
(d) promptly, and in any event within five Business Days after receipt thereof by any Loan Party or any Subsidiary thereof, copies of each notice or other correspondence received from the SEC (or comparable agency in any applicable non-U.S. jurisdiction) concerning any investigation or possible investigation or other inquiry by such agency regarding financial or other operational results of any Loan Party or any Subsidiary thereof; and
(e) promptly, such additional information regarding the business, financial or corporate affairs of the Borrower or any Subsidiary, or compliance with the terms of the Loan Documents, as the Administrative Agent, at the request of any Lender, may from time to time reasonably request. Certificates; Other Information. Furnish to the Administrative Agent with copies for each Lender:
(a) concurrently with the delivery of the financial statements referred to in subsection 6.1, a certificate of the independent certified public accountants reporting on such financial statements stating that, in performing their audit, nothing came to their attention that caused them to believe that the Borrower failed to comply with the provisions of subsection 7.1, except as specified in such certificate;
(b) concurrently with the delivery of the financial statements referred to in subsection 6.1, a certificate of a Responsible Officer stating that, to the best of such Officer's knowledge, during such period (i) no Subsidiary has been formed or acquired (or, if any such Subsidiary has been formed or acquired, the Borrower has complied with the requirements of subsection 6.10 with respect thereto) and (ii) such Officer has obtained no knowledge of any Default or Event of Default except as specified in such certificate;
(c) concurrently with the delivery of financial statements pursuant to subsection 6.1, a certificate of a Responsible Officer of the Borrower setting forth, in reasonable detail, the computations, as applicable, of (i) the Debt Ratio and (ii) the financial covenants set forth in subsection 7.1, as of such last day or for the fiscal period then ended, as the case may be;
(d) not later than 60 days after the end of each fiscal year of the Borrower, a copy of the projections by the Borrower of the operating budget and cash flow budget of the Borrower and its Subsidiaries for the succeeding fiscal year, such projections to be accompanied by a certificate of a Responsible Officer to the effect that such projections have been prepared on the basis of sound financial planning practice and that such Officer has no reason to believe they are incorrect or misleading in any material respect;
(e) within five days after the same are sent, copies of all financial statements and reports which the Borrower or Holdings sends to its stockholders; and
(f) promptly, such additional financial and other information as any Lender may from time to time reasonably request.
